Electric Vehicles: The Future of Driving
The automotive market is on the brink of a revolution, with electric vehicles (EVs) rapidly emerging as the preferred choice for environmentally conscious drivers. These zero-emission marvels offer a compelling alternative to gasoline-powered cars, promising reduced pollution. As battery technology continues to evolve, EVs are becoming more affordable for the average consumer.
- Governments worldwide are encouraging policies that favor EV adoption, further accelerating their rise in popularity.
- Major automotive companies are investing heavily in EV research, rolling out an ever-expanding variety of models to address diverse needs and preferences.
From sleek SUVs to practical city vehicles, EVs are proving that sustainability can go hand-in-hand with style and performance. The future of driving is electric, and it's here sooner than you think.
Automotive Technology Advancements driving Us Forward
The automotive industry is in a constant state of evolution, with advancements emerging at an unprecedented rate. From the integration of artificial intelligence to the rise of autonomous vehicles, the future of transportation is being shaped by cutting-edge technology.
One remarkable trend is the increasing use of electric powertrains. Hybrid vehicles are gaining popularity as consumers desire more sustainable and environmentally friendly choices. Furthermore, connectivity technology is altering the driving experience.
Features such as smartphone integration, real-time traffic updates, and advanced driver assistance systems are augmenting safety and convenience on the road. As technology continues to advance, we can expect even more revolutionary advancements that will transform the automotive landscape.
Crafting the Automotive Aesthetic
Vehicle design is a dynamic discipline where creativity seamlessly intersects with engineering prowess. Designers strive to conceptualize vehicles that are not only functional but also appealing in appearance. From the sleek lines of a sports car to the rugged silhouette of an SUV, each design element tells a story and communicates the vehicle's personality.
The design process is a multifaceted journey that involves drawing, computer-aided drafting, and meticulous evaluation. Designers work together with engineers, marketers, and executives to ensure the final product meets both aesthetic and performance standards.
- Influencing trends in automotive design often involves researching new materials, technologies, and design concepts.
- Sustainability is increasingly becoming a key factor in vehicle design, with designers implementing eco-friendly practices and materials.
Road Safety Matters
When you hit the road, keep top of mind that your health is paramount. Always fasten your seatbelt. Obey all traffic laws and signs. Maintain vigilance of your surroundings, scanning for pedestrians, cyclists, and other vehicles. Avoid distractions like mobile devices, as they can lead to serious accidents.
If you plan on driving at night, make sure your headlights are functioning properly. Rest often to avoid driver fatigue.
Remember, being a responsible driver means putting safety first.
